Overview

Flowers Foods, Inc., headquartered in Thomasville, Georgia, is a premier producer and marketer of packaged bakery goods in the United States. Since its inception in 1919, initially known as Flowers Industries before rebranding in 2001, the company has dedicated itself to delivering high-quality bakery products. Serving a wide range of customers, Flowers Foods caters to national and regional restaurants, institutions, foodservice distributors, and retail in-store bakeries. It also extends its distribution to wholesale distributors, mass merchandisers, supermarkets, vending outlets, convenience stores, quick-serve chains, food wholesalers, institutions like public healthcare, military commissaries, prisons, other governmental bodies, dollar stores, and vending companies. The company employs a mixed distribution model leveraging direct-store-delivery and warehouse delivery systems and operates several bakeries to meet its production needs.

Products and Services

  • Fresh Breads, Buns, Rolls: Flowers Foods offers an assortment of freshly baked breads, buns, and rolls, catering to the daily needs of consumers and culinary professionals. These come under well-known brand names ensuring quality and taste.
  • Snack Items: The company provides a variety of snack items, including pastries and sweet treats under the Mrs. Freshley's and Tastykake brand names. These products are popular in snack markets, vending outlets, and convenience stores.
  • Bagels, English Muffins: Catering to breakfast and snack times, Flowers Foods offers a selection of bagels and English muffins, expanding its reach into various meal segments.
  • Tortillas: Reflecting the diverse preferences of consumers, the company also ventures into the production of tortillas, touching on the increasingly popular Mexican cuisine.
  • Frozen Breads and Rolls: Understanding the need for convenience and longer shelf-life, Flowers Foods offers frozen breads and rolls, which are handy for both retail and foodservice sectors.

The company distributes its wide range of products through a comprehensive direct-store-delivery system and a warehouse delivery system, ensuring widespread accessibility and convenience for its customers. Operating under esteemed brand names such as Nature's Own, Dave's Killer Bread, Wonder, Canyon Bakehouse, Mrs. Freshley's, and Tastykake, Flowers Foods has cemented its presence in the packaged bakery food products market, providing quality and variety to various segments of consumers.
